About the role.
The Sr. Director - Infrastructure AI & Automated Operations is a critical global leadership role responsible for driving McCain's 2030 digital transformation through an AI-first, automation-first infrastructure strategy. Reporting to the VP, Infrastructure Engineering & Operations, this role leads the modernization of global IT infrastructure across data centers, cloud, networking, end-user services, and enterprise platforms.
This leader will embed DevOps, Site Reliability Engineering (SRE), observability, and GenAI/Agentic AI into IT operations to deliver resilient, scalable, and future-ready infrastructure supporting McCain's global manufacturing plants and offices. The role will also oversee vendor ecosystems, drive innovation, and ensure operational excellence across all infrastructure services.

About the team.
This role is part of McCain's Global Infrastructure, Engineering & Operations organization. The Sr. Director leads a team of 5-10 direct reports and oversees a broader ecosystem of 100-150 indirect and vendor resources. The team operates globally, supporting 24/7 infrastructure and applications across McCain's manufacturing plants, offices, and digital platforms. This leader collaborates closely with cross-functional technology teams, security, and business stakeholders to deliver enterprise-wide impact.

As a privately owned family company with over 60 years of experience, a presence in over 160 countries and a global team of 22,000 people, our values and culture are at the heart of everything we do. Our product quality, people and customer dedication help us achieve global sales in excess of CDN $10 billion. Through our investment and innovation, we continue to be a global leader in prepared potato products, including our famous French Fries and appetizers.
